How much do java selenium jobs pay per hour?

As of Jul 1, 2026, the average hourly pay for java selenium in Illinois is $49.85,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$41.25 and $57.55 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the Java Selenium position,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Java Selenium professional, you need strong proficiency in Java programming, expertise in Selenium WebDriver for UI automation testing, and a solid understanding of testing frameworks like TestNG or JUnit. Experience with CI/CD tools (such as Jenkins), version control systems (like Git), and relevant certifications in automation testing are highly valued. Attention to detail, problem-solving ability, and effective teamwork and communication skills help professionals excel in this field. These competencies ensure reliable test automation, efficient bug identification, and seamless collaboration within software development teams.

What are the primary responsibilities of a Java Selenium Automation Tester on a typical project team?

A Java Selenium Automation Tester is responsible for designing, developing, and executing automated test scripts to ensure software quality and functionality. On a typical project team, you will collaborate closely with developers, business analysts, and manual testers, reviewing requirements, identifying test scenarios, and reporting defects. You may participate in daily stand-ups, sprint planning, and code reviews to stay aligned with the team’s development process. This role often involves maintaining and enhancing existing test frameworks, configuring test environments, and working in Agile or DevOps-focused teams that value continuous improvement.

What is a Java Selenium job?

A Java Selenium job typically involves using Java programming and the Selenium framework for automating web application testing. Professionals in this role write test scripts, execute automated test cases, and identify defects in web applications. They often work with frameworks like TestNG or JUnit and may integrate Selenium with tools like Maven, Jenkins, or Cucumber. These roles are commonly found in software testing, quality assurance, and automation engineering.
